新闻中心
-
12-03深浅拷贝实现原理_j*ascript对象操作浅拷贝只复制对象第一层属性,引用类型共享内存,修改嵌套对象会影响原对象;深拷贝递归复制所有层级,生成完全独立的对象。常用浅拷贝方法有Object.assign、...
-
12-03如何使用Golang reflect实现通用复制函数_Golang reflect深浅拷贝策略Go语言中可通过reflect实现深浅拷贝,浅拷贝共享引用数据,深拷贝递归复制所有层级并需处理循环引用;反射无法访问非导出字段或特殊类型,且不调用自定义序列化方...
-
12-03c++ 深拷贝和浅拷贝 c++拷贝构造函数教程深拷贝会为新对象分配独立内存并复制数据,确保对象间不共享资源;浅拷贝仅复制指针值,导致多个对象共享同一内存,可能引发重复释放问题。当类含有动态内存指针时,必须实...
-
11-16JS深浅拷贝实现_对象复制技巧对比浅拷贝只复制对象第一层属性,深层仍共享引用,常用方法有Object.assign、扩展运算符;深拷贝则递归复制所有层级,实现方式包括JSON.parse(JSO...
-
共1页 4条

